How to Install Kerkythea Plugin in SketchUp?

Understanding Kerkythea and Its Integration with SketchUp

Kerkythea is a powerful rendering application that provides photorealistic rendering capabilities at no cost. Its integration with SketchUp allows users to leverage advanced rendering techniques to enhance their architectural and design projects. Here’s a detailed guide on how to install the Kerkythea plugin in SketchUp.

Step-by-Step Installation Guide for Kerkythea Plugin

Step 1: Download the Kerkythea Plugin

Begin by downloading the Kerkythea software from the official website. Ensure that you choose the latest version compatible with your operating system. Once downloaded, locate the file on your computer.

Step 2: Open SketchUp

Launch the SketchUp application on your computer. Wait for the program to fully load to access your projects or start a new design.

Step 3: Export Your Model from SketchUp

Prepare your model in SketchUp for rendering. Once satisfied with your design, it’s time to export it. Go to File in the top menu, then hover over Export, and select 2D Graphic. Choose the appropriate format (such as .xml), which is needed for further processing in Kerkythea.

Step 4: Locate the Kerkythea Plugin Directory

To install the plugin effectively, you need to direct it to the SketchUp Plugins folder.

  • For Windows users, the path typically looks like:
    C:\Users\[Your Username]\AppData\Roaming\SketchUp\SketchUp [Version]\Plugins\

  • For Mac users, navigate to:
    [Your Username]/Library/Application Support/SketchUp [Version]/SketchUp/Plugins/

Copy the downloaded Kerkythea plugin files into this directory.

Step 5: Install the Plugin in SketchUp

Back in SketchUp, go to Extensions in the main menu, and then select Extension Manager. This is where you will be able to manage your plugins. Here, find the Kerkythea plugin and ensure it is checked or enabled.

Step 6: Launch Kerkythea from SketchUp

After the installation, navigate back to your design in SketchUp. You can now export your enhanced model into Kerkythea for rendering. Simply click File, and select Export, then choose the Kerkythea export option. You can find the XML file you previously created and open it in the Kerkythea application.

Step 7: Begin Rendering in Kerkythea

Upon opening the XML file in Kerkythea, your model should display in wireframe mode. For a more realistic preview, switch to solid rendering mode by going to the View menu, selecting Adjust, and choosing Solid Rendering, or simply pressing the V key on your keyboard.

What type of projects can I use Kerkythea for?
Kerkythea is particularly suited for architectural visualizations, interior design renders, and product visualizations. Its customizable rendering settings allow users to create detailed presentations of various types of designs.

Is technical support available for Kerkythea users?
Yes, Kerkythea offers a variety of resources for users, including forums, user guides, and community support to help resolve any installation or rendering issues.
